What is automatic irrigation system using soil energy?
‘AUTOMATIC IRRIGATION SYSTEM USING SOLAR ENERGY’ as the name specifies that it irrigates the field when the moisture value of soil is below the reference value and it will automatically turn off when the moisture value in soil exceeds that reference value. 1.1. What is automatic drip irrigation?
Automatic Drip Irrigation is an extremely useful tool for precisely controlling soil moisture. Additionally, it assists in saving time, eliminating human error in adjusting available soil moisture levels, and optimizing their net yield. Farmers can mitigate runoff caused by overwatering saturated soils.

Learn More →Design and Implementation of Solar Powered Automatic Irrigation System
It is a device that is solar powered, as an alternative source of power supply to the entire irrigation system. The solar power supply consist of two modules or panels, a battery and charge regulator whose function is to control the battery charge and as well supply power to the load (motor) at various weather and soil moisture conditions ...
